>>>> The "i386-pc" version built from OSX doesn't work.
>>>> It will only display Grub Loading…
>>>>
> Not surprising. Apple misassembler generates correct 16-bit code only
> when stars are right.
> Every version of Apple misassembler has bugs, every version they are
> different. You'd need to disassemble the resulting code and compare it
> with original file to know which instructions are wrong.
> Just a hunch: it may be ADDR32/DATA32. Attached is my experimental patch
> for removal of ADDR32/DATA32
Same Error with the patch: only Grub Loading… is displayed.
Do you want some files to find the differences with grub compiled on linux ?
